Kell’s Fall is the newest Exotic mission in Destiny 2. Players return to the Tangled Shore to hunt down Fikrul, who is guarded by some of the fiercest Scorn enemies in a deserted watchtower near the coast. If you manage to overcome these challenges and defeat Fikrul, you’ll receive a new Exotic Shotgun along with seasonal gear.
Upon completing this mission, you will obtain Slayer’s Fang, an Exotic Shotgun featuring ricocheting shots and granting truesight on kills. This weapon is incredibly powerful if used correctly, but first, you’ll have to unlock it. Kell’s Fall Difficulty Options
Like most Exotic missions, Kell’s Fall offers two levels of difficulty: Normal and Expert. In Normal mode, the Power requirement is set at 1,995, with only elemental surges and enemy threats enabled. The Expert mode, however, features Champions, an Overcharge mechanic, and increases the Power requirement to 2,015 with a -15 Power delta, making enemies significantly tougher.
The activity objectives and puzzles remain the same across both modes.

Battle the Trickster
Your journey in Kell’s Fall begins at the Dreaming City’s watchtower on the Tangled Shore, a location last seen during the Forsaken campaign. When you spawn, turn right and follow the ledges to reach the watchtower. If you encounter Scorn along the path, you’re headed in the right direction.
Once you arrive at the watchtower’s courtyard, a Trickster Baron and a group of Scorn will ambush you. You’ll need to deplete about a third of the Trickster’s health to escape. The key mechanic here is that the Trickster becomes immune after it stops moving, so make sure to unleash your Heavy ammo on it during these moments. After the Trickster retreats, proceed into the tower.
Investigate the Fortress
In the fortress, you’ll first notice a massive pipe organ. This instrument won’t help in completing the mission just yet, but you can find codes throughout Kell’s Fall that can unlock bonus loot. For now, head up the stairs to your left and light the brazier to progress.
During certain encounters and puzzles, you’ll come across unlit braziers. You need to light three of these to unlock a nearby door, and there is no timer for this task.
After lighting the brazier, you’ll enter a hallway with a large branch at one end. Look past the closest branch, and you’ll find a wall of debris that can be destroyed with your weapon. Slide through the opening to discover a peculiar mirror. Shoot it to shatter the glass and reveal your next path.
Stepping through this mirror transports you to a mirrored version of reality, where you’ll face a few Dread and Scorn foes. Nothing overly challenging for a well-prepared Guardian. Continue through this linear path to find another mirror, break it, and return to your original dimension.
Once back, activate two braziers nearby. One should appear close to the portal, while the other will be located up the stairs. Lighting both will open the way to the first encounter. Next, break the rubble on the right wall, slide through, and follow the path until you reach the fighting pit.
Defeat the Mad Bomber
Your primary goal for this encounter is to enter the mirror realm, gain Revenant Empowerment, take down two Abominations, and then defeat the Mad Bomber. Enemies will spawn around the fighting ring when the encounter begins. You can either clear them out now or start the mechanics. A mirror will begin cracking in the center of the room. Shoot it and walk inside.
Inside the mirrored realm, you’ll find several Dread enemies, particularly Revenant Essentia, which is a variant of a Dread Weaver. Defeating them will drop three motes that grant Revenant Essence. You need ten stacks of this essence to damage immune enemies in the material realm. Once you collect ten stacks, use the mirror at the edge of the fighting ring to return.
Revenant Essence lasts for 45 seconds, but collecting ten stacks will reset the timer.
With Revenant Empowerment, you can now damage the previously immune Abomination foes in the chamber. There are two total, each located on opposite sides. Take your time; eliminating both will cause the Mad Bomber to spawn, along with additional enemies. Ensure that you’re prepared before taking down the second Abomination.
The Mad Bomber behaves similarly to the variant from Forsaken, throwing explosives your way and being quite aggressive. There are no mechanics complicating the fight here. Bring out your strongest Heavy weapon and quickly cut down the boss’s health. Defeating the Mad Bomber ends this encounter.
Find the Sanctum
More revived barons await you as you delve deeper into the fortress. Your next destination is the sanctum, which you access via the exit door in the top-right corner of the fighting ring. Follow this path a short way until you arrive in a large, red-lit cavern. Follow the ledges and structures to your left. Climb as high as you can, and look across the chasm for an exit cave.
Defeat the Mindbender
Before starting this encounter, light three braziers in the material realm. You’ll find one behind the Rally Flag and two near the mirror in the next room. It’s important to bring a strong burst DPS Heavy weapon for this confrontation, as the damage phases have time limits.
Entering the sanctum leads to a spacious area within the watchtower, where you will face the Mindbender. Just like the previous Trickster, you’ll need to deplete a third of the boss’s health for it to retreat but be aware of the two-minute timer while inside the mirror realm. It’s crucial to deal damage to the boss and escape before the timer expires.
Luckily, the exit isn’t hard to find. Once you damage the boss sufficiently, head toward the hole on the left side of the sanctum. Upon sliding through, you’ll encounter several Thrall. Eliminate them and check the far end of the corridor for a Brazier. If one is present, light it.
Then, backtrack halfway down the hall and make a left into a small cavern protected by a few Hive Wizards. Take them down, clear out the Acolytes, and use the mirror at the room’s end to make your escape.
In the material realm, light two nearby braziers to unlock a door. Both braziers should appear based on your explorations. Once lit, return to the mirror, but don’t enter it just yet. Look up for a ledge behind the mirror that you can jump onto. Go inside to begin the second damage phase.
This phase mirrors the first: damage the boss until it phases, then head through the exit door to find another mirror. You’ll return to the initial sanctum room but with another timer. Ensure that you eliminate the boss before time runs out.
Defeat The Trickster Again
Although not a significant encounter, this section serves as a precursor to the final battle. You’ll need to ascend a spiral staircase and take down the Trickster from earlier. This fight mirrors the start of the mission: wait for the Trickster to stop moving, then unleash your most powerful abilities and Heavy weapon. No wiping mechanics will penalize you here, so take your time. The doors at the staircase’s top will open once you defeat the boss.
Defeat The Revenants
Fikrul has transformed the throne room into a fortress, and it’s up to you to stop his plans. Before starting, make sure to equip a solid mid-range DPS weapon and a build focused on survivability. Grenade Launchers and Swords perform well in this fight.
This encounter kicks off with you needing to eliminate Scorn enemies that spawn in the arena. Keep an eye on the mirror past Fikrul’s spawning area. After taking down enough foes, Fikrul will initiate a wipe mechanic. When you see him charging up his staff, jump through the mirror before the wipe kicks in.
Inside the mirror realm, you’ll face a mix of Dread and Scorn foes, including Overload and Unstoppable Champions if you’re on Expert. Similar to the Mad Bomber fight, you’ll need to defeat Revenant Essentia in the arena to earn Revenant Empowerment. Collecting ten stacks allows you to return to the material realm to confront Fikrul directly. If you’ve completed the Act 3 quest, you’ll face Fikrul in the mirror realm instead.
When fighting Fikrul, you need to damage the mirror to begin the damage phase. You only have a few seconds to inflict damage before you must escape; make the time count.
The buffs you gathered earlier will allow you to damage the boss. Break the shield, then unleash everything you have to take him down. There’s no strict DPS window in the mirrored realm (except for the Fikrul scenario), so take your time, play it safe, and use your Super often, alongside your Heavy weapon. Finishing this encounter will complete Kell’s Fall and reward you with the Slayer’s Fang Exotic Shotgun.
